    Tonight's episode was very confusing....."Shotgun Wedding" is a two-parter with the 2nd part being a Laverne & Shirley episode. The Happy Days portion ends with Richie racing off to find L&S to help save the Fonz who is being held by a shotgun toting farmer. Cut to the Fonz meeting up with Mr. C and explaining how he got away without Richie's help. This is the syndicated version.

    However, the Hub follows it up with the L&S episode where the girls accompany Richie to rescue the Fonz from the farmer.

    If anything they should have removed that tag ending with Fonzie and Mr. C and then it would have flowed better and made more sense....
